Shidie is a modern, multicultural name believed to derive from a fusion of African and Asian linguistic roots, symbolizing 'bringer of light' and 'wisdom.' It carries connotations of enlightenment, intelligence, and guidance, reflecting a hopeful, bright future for the bearer. The name blends contemporary creativity with a timeless aspiration for knowledge and clarity.
